Output 181673cb55c94b2f93844c508a4f102fd232149394a04dc0fe112e0a0ed69e3e:1

value
2842604803
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 134a6d28bd9debec2c39c10418b6915982d9286d OP_EQUALVERIFY OP_CHECKSIG
address
12kzzt9k9NsjDkahYVMLScvH4fEp4LcMeL
transaction
181673cb55c94b2f93844c508a4f102fd232149394a04dc0fe112e0a0ed69e3e
spent
true